Top 20 Best Texas Private Preschools Belonging to National Association of Episcopal Schools (NAES) (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 47 private preschools belonging to National Association of Episcopal Schools (NAES) serving 11,723 students in Texas. You can also find more schools membership associations in Texas.
The top ranked private preschools belonging to National Association of Episcopal Schools (NAES) in Texas include St. Thomas' Episcopal School, St. Lukes Episcopal School, and Trinity School Of Texas.
The average tuition cost is $14,879, which is higher than the Texas private preschool average tuition cost of $13,478.
100% of private preschools belonging to National Association of Episcopal Schools (NAES) in Texas are religiously affiliated (most commonly Episcopal and Catholic).
